Standard BioTools Inc. (NASDAQ: LAB), operating within the Healthcare sector, specifically in the Medical Devices industry, is drawing investor attention with its potential for a 28.62% upside based on analyst target prices. With a current market capitalization of $527.15 million, this South San Francisco-based company is poised at an interesting juncture for investors seeking opportunities in the biomedical instrumentation space.

The company is known for its innovative solutions in Proteomics and Genomics, offering a suite of products and services that aid scientists and researchers worldwide. Its offerings such as the SomaScan platform and CyTOF technology are pivotal for deep biological insights, proving indispensable for academic and clinical research institutions, as well as biopharmaceutical and biotechnology companies.

Currently, Standard BioTools trades at $1.38 per share, reflecting a modest 0.05% increase. Despite its challenges, as indicated by a negative revenue growth of 14.20% and an EPS of -0.37, the company’s stock has demonstrated resilience. It navigates within a 52-week range of $0.92 to $2.26, with its price lingering above both the 50-day and 200-day moving averages, suggesting some level of stability in its trading patterns.

Valuation metrics present a mixed picture. The Forward P/E ratio stands at -34.50, indicating that the company is still grappling with profitability issues. However, this could also be a reflection of the company’s investment in future growth and technological advancements, which could potentially yield returns in the long term. The absence of traditional valuation ratios such as P/E, PEG, and Price/Book, alongside significant negative free cash flow, might raise caution among conservative investors.

From an analyst perspective, Standard BioTools has garnered one Buy and two Hold ratings, with no Sell recommendations, reflecting a cautiously optimistic sentiment. The target price range of $1.55 to $2.00 suggests a potential increase, with an average target of $1.78, indicating a substantial room for growth from its current levels.

Technical indicators further support a neutral to slightly positive outlook. The RSI of 54.55 suggests that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, while the MACD and Signal Line remain neutral, indicating a potential for future upward momentum.
